Directions
blank
Bring the heavy cream to room temperature. In a medium saucepan over high heat, mix 1¼ cups sugar and ½ cup water. Let it boil until the sugar starts to brown evenly.
Finish the caramel:
Turn off heat and carefully add the cream—it will bubble and steam. Whisk until bubbling stops, stir in ¼ tsp salt, and let cool. Transfer to a heatproof bowl or jar.
blank
Preheat oven to 350°F. In a large bowl, whisk together vegetable oil, 1½ cups sugar, vanilla extract, and eggs. Add flour, baking powder, cocoa powder, and ¼ tsp salt. Mix until smooth.
blank
Lightly grease a 9x9" baking pan with oil or butter. Pour in the batter and smooth out the top.
blank
Spoon about 10 small dollops of caramel over the batter. Swirl gently with a spoon, creating pockets without overmixing.
blank
Bake for 18–20 minutes, or until the center is set and no longer glossy. Cool on a wire rack. Once cooled, cut into squares, drizzle with more caramel, and sprinkle with flaked sea salt.
